School Hours

  • KINDERGARTEN & FIRST GRADE  | 8:20 a.m. ā€“ 1:50 p.m.
  • SECOND GRADE ā€“ FIFTH GRADE | 8:35 a.m. – 3:05 p.m.
  • WEDNESDAYS: 2nd-5th Grade | 8:35 a.m. ā€“ 1:50 p.m
  • Cafeteria Hours | 7:30-8:10

Student Drop-Off Pick-up

All parents are strongly encouraged not to allow your child to sit in front of the school prior to 7:30 a.m. There is no supervision until 7:45. Students are to be dropped of in the street or staff parking lot.

Rainy Day Dismissal

Students should have a hooded raincoat/poncho available for use on rainy days. Instruct your child as to what procedures to follow on rainy days at dismissal time. During lightning storms, students will be kept in classrooms during dismissal until the storm ceases. Parents may choose to come in the classroom to pick-up a child during a lightning storm (or heavy rain) if they cannot wait for the storm to cease.
